DEPARTMENT OF VETERANS AFFAIRS


Advisory Committee Charter Renewals

AGENCY: Department of Veterans Affairs.

ACTION: Notice of Advisory Committee Charter Renewals.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: In accordance with the provisions of the Federal Advisory 
Committee ACT (FACA), 5 U.S.C. App. 2, and after consultation with the 
General Services Administration, the Secretary of Veterans Affairs has 
determined that the following Federal advisory committees are vital to 
the mission of the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) and renewing 
their charters would be in the public interest. Consequently, the 
charters for the following Federal advisory committees are renewed for 
a two-year period, beginning on the dates listed below:

----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
            Committee name                           Committee description                  Charter renewed on
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Genomic Medicine Program Advisory      Provides advice on the scientific and ethical     March 28, 2016.
 Committee.                             issues related to the establishment,
                                        development, and operation of a genomic
                                        medicine program within VA.
VA National Academic Affiliations      Provides advice to the Secretary regarding        April 29, 2016.
 Council.                               partnerships between VA and its academic
                                        affiliates.
Veterans' Rural Health Advisory        Provides advice to the Secretary on health care   May 2, 2016.
 Committee.                             issues affecting enrolled Veterans residing in
                                        rural areas.
* Cooperative Studies Scientific       Provides advice on VA cooperative studies, multi- May 4, 2016.
 Evaluation Committee.                  site clinical research activities, and policies
                                        related to conducting and managing these
                                        efforts; ensures that new and ongoing projects
                                        maintain high quality, are based upon
                                        scientific merit, mission relevance, and are
                                        efficiently and economically conducted.

[[Page 29330]]

 
Health Services Research and           Provides advice on the fair and equitable         May 4, 2016.
 Development Service Scientific Merit   selection of the most meritorious research
 Review Board.                          projects for support by VA research funds and
                                        ensures the high quality and mission relevance
                                        of VA's legislatively mandated research and
                                        development program. Also advises on the
                                        adequacy of protection of human and animal
                                        subjects.
Joint Biomedical Laboratory Research   Provides advice on the scientific quality,        May 4, 2016.
 and Development and Clinical Science   budget, safety, and mission relevance of
 Research and Development Services      investigator-initiated research proposals
 Scientific Merit Review Board.         submitted for VA merit review consideration.
                                        The proposals may address research questions
                                        within the general areas of biomedical and
                                        behavioral research or clinical science
                                        research.
Rehabilitation Research and            Provides advice on the fair and equitable         May 4, 2016.
 Development Service Scientific Merit   selection of the most meritorious research
 Review Board.                          projects for support by VA research funds;
                                        provides advice for research programs officials
                                        on program priorities and policies; and ensures
                                        that the VA Rehabilitation Research and
                                        Development program promotes functional
                                        independence and improves the quality of life
                                        for impaired and disabled Veterans.
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
* Note: The Cooperative Studies Scientific Evaluation Committee was formerly named Clinical Science Research and
  Development Service Cooperative Studies Scientific Evaluation Committee.

    The Secretary has also renewed the charters for the following 
statutorily authorized Federal advisory committees for a two-year 
period, beginning on the dates listed below:

----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
            Committee name                           Committee description                  Charter renewed on
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Advisory Committee on Minority         Authorized by 38 U.S.C. Sec.   544. Provides      March 7, 2016.
 Veterans.                              advice on the administration of VA benefits for
                                        Veterans who are minority group members in the
                                        areas of compensation, health care,
                                        rehabilitation, outreach, and other services.
Advisory Committee on the              Authorized by 38 U.S.C. Sec.   545. Provides      April 16, 2016.
 Readjustment of Veterans.              advice to the Secretary on policies,
                                        organizational structures, and the provision
                                        and coordination of services to address
                                        Veterans' post-war readjustment to civilian
                                        life, with particular emphasis on post-
                                        traumatic stress disorder, alcoholism, other
                                        substance abuse, post-war employment, and
                                        family adjustment.
Special Medical Advisory Group.......  Authorized by 38 U.S.C. Sec.   7312. Provides     April 16, 2016.
                                        advice to the Secretary and the Under Secretary
                                        for Health on matters relating to the care and
                                        treatment of Veterans and other matters
                                        pertinent to the operations of the Veterans
                                        Health Administration, such as research,
                                        education, training of health manpower, and VA/
                                        DoD contingency planning.
Advisory Committee on Former           Authorized by 38 U.S.C. Sec.   541. Provides      April 18, 2016.
 Prisoners of War.                      advice to the Secretary on the administration
                                        of benefits for Veterans who are former
                                        prisoners of war, and to assess the needs of
                                        such Veterans in the areas of service-connected
                                        compensation, health care, and rehabilitation.
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
